Proportion of teachers with the minimum required qualifications in in Madagascar, 2012–2019
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in %.
Analysis
In 2019, proportion of teachers with the minimum required qualifications in in Madagascar stood at 15.3%.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 3.8% on the previous year and down 27.2% over ten years.
Madagascar ranks 138th of 139 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
Proportion of teachers with the minimum required qualifications in in Madagascar,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2012 | 21.0% | — |
| 2013 | 18.9% | -9.9% |
| 2014 | 16.7% | -11.9% |
| 2015 | 15.1% | -9.5% |
| 2016 | 14.9% | -1.4% |
| 2017 | 14.8% | -0.2% |
| 2018 | 14.7% | -0.9% |
| 2019 | 15.3% | +3.8% |
